Black mesh basket 11 x 5.5 high new product: These sidewall holes promote water drainage and encourage the air movement around the plant's root system. Air movement around a potted plant's root system mimics the wind and breezes that would constantly flow around an orchid root system in nature. Many orchid pots, both clay, and plastic have side holes or slits. Always choose a pot with drainage holes.
